WARNING AND ERROR MESSAGES
The Power Peak D7 is equipped with special safety features to ensure safe and reliable charging and
discharging operations. As soon as a fault occurs, a corresponding error message will appear on the screen,
and the buzzer emits a warning sound. After eliminating the cause, you can clear this message by pressing
the STOP/ESC button.
